<p>The conical mirror (7), for illuminating the dial markings (5) around a clock face (1), receives incident light, falling on the mirror (7) from behind the clock, and concentrates the light onto the rear of each transparent dial marking (5). The conical mirror (7) may be in the form of a ring concentric with the clock face, or it may be formed by a silvered annular ridge in the surface of a transparent plate behind the watch face. The battery and drive circuit for the clock may be contained in a support base, with the clock face (1) being adjustable on the base for optional illumination of the dial markings (5).</p> |
